Snap Dragon Dairy Stars
Classification is an unbiased evaluation of goats, using the breed standard as set
forth by the Candian Goat Society.
Snap Dragon Dairy and its line of Gnome Wood Dairy Goats are extremely proud to announce
our first doe to be classified as EXCELLENT!
Gnome Wood Sweet
Sapphire, a purebred 5 year-old Toggenburg doe, was awarded this
prestigious score on July 16th, 2011 by Kathy Smith.
Sapphire is one of the foundation does in our dairy herd and the granddaughter of La Mountain GNA Duchess - another founding
doe in our herd.

Snap Dragon Dairy - Future Plans
Snap Dragon Dairy is actively looking into the idea of making goat milk ice cream from our own pure and beautiful goat milk. We plan
on using locally produced organic blueberries, raspberries, wild-harvest black berries and huckleberries, locally grown walnuts, and big-leaf
maple syrup.
Goat milk ice cream, with half the fat of regular ice cream, tastes wonderful and would be available to all the lactose intolerant souls, unable to enjoy ice cream! We will keep you informed.
